Shadow of a Doubt: Perceptive Americana entangled with tale of youthful gal who gradually comes to grasp her cherished Uncle Charley is seriously the Merry Widow Killer. Cast includes Teresa Wright, Joseph Cotten, Macdonald Carey, Patricia Collinge, Henry Travers, Wallace Ford, and Hume Cronyn. (108 minutes, 1943)

Rebel: Tiresome, justifiably vague time tablet characterizing Stallone, pre-stardom, as a disassociated political extremist (a fascinating balance to Rambo). Cast includes Antony Page, Sylvester E. Stallone, Rebecca Dirties, and Henry G. Sanders. (112 minutes, 1974)

Bootmen: Novice director Perry (of the dance group Tap Dogs) used his own background to develop this toe tapping film of a youthful gentleman’s escape into big-time show business, and then back once more as he rallies his blue collar tap-dancing cronies to build his own modern-day dance show. Cast includes Adam Garcia, Sam Worthington, Sophie Lee, Christopher Horsey, Lee McDonald, William Zappa, and Richard Carter. (93 minutes, 2000)

The Little Theatre of Jean Renoir: A quartet of little stories in reference to human respectability and the beneficence of country living (instead of subsisting in a dehumanized city forest). Renoir’s celluloid swan song might not be amid his best, however still has much to offer. Cast includes Jeanne Moreau, Femand Sardou, Francoise Arnoul, Jean Carmet, Marguerite Cassan, and Dominique Labourier. (100 minutes, 1971)

Days of Glory: A genuine although trudging WW2 action film pitting the Russians versus the Nazis, memorable only as Peck?s big screen debut. Cast includes Gregory Peck, Alan Reed, Maria Palmer, Lowell Gilmore, and Tamara Toumanova. (86 minutes, 1944)

Night Watch: Weak, perplexing, and endless continuation to Day Watch in which the powers of the “light” and the “dark” are at it once more. After being framed, Anton (Khabensky) tries to spare himself and his child from wicked powers in post-apocalyptic Russia. Cast includes Konstantin Khabensky, Mariya poroshina, Vladimir Menshov, Galina Tyunina, and Viktor Verzhbitsky. (132 minutes, 2006)

Rambling Rose: An evocative story set in 1930s Georgia, with Dem as an oversexed senseless gal who comes to work for a ladylike family headed by Duvall and Ladd. Vibrant, pleasantly detailed, and well performed, with numerous delightful surprises during the voyage. Cast includes Laura Dem, Robert Duvall, Diane Ladd, Lukas Haas, John Heard, Kevin Conway, Robert J. Burke, Lisa Jakub, and Evan Lockwood. (112 minutes, 1991)

My Son the Hero: An epic film in regards to the sinister Emperor Cadmus of Thebes, who challenges the lords and faces the fury of the Titans. Cast includes Pedro Armendariz, Jacqueline Sassard, Antonella Lualdi, and Giuliano Gemma. (122 minutes, 1962)

The Alamo: The film covers the impassioned series of events leading up to the legendary 1836 siege in San Antonio, Texas. A more precise rendition than earlier renderings of the tale, it still battles to handle the numerous elements of this historical occurrence. Cast includes Billy Bob Thornton, Dennis Quaid, Jason Patric, Patrick Wilson, and Emilio Echeverria (135 minutes, 2004)
